UN warns Taliban that restrictions on Afghan women and girls make recognition #39;nearly impossible#39;

Roza Otunbayeva told the U.N. Security Council that the Taliban have asked to be recognized by the United Nations and its 192 other member nations, “but at the same time they act against the key values expressed in the United Nations Charter.�
